Blinken, UAE foreign minister discuss Sudan conflict -State Department
- Country:
- United States
U.S. Secretary of State Antony Blinken and UAE Foreign Minister Sheikh Abdullah bin Zayed Al Nahyan discussed in a call on Wednesday the importance of ending the conflict in Sudan, the State Department said in a statement.
Blinken also welcomed the deal to release hostages held by Hamas in Gaza and reaffirmed the importance of addressing the humanitarian needs in Gaza, the statement said.
